QR codes have greatly impacted the way people purchase from their physical and online businesses in four important ways, in response to many retail stores’ need to modernize their means of operations during the COVID-19 pandemic and the betterment of their future shoppers’ shopping experience.

Check-ins by customers 

Customer check-ins 

With a restricted number of individuals authorized to shop in their stores at any given time, businesses have used QR codes to track how many people have checked in by monitoring the scan results of the check-in QR code in real-time. Shoppers are now required to scan the QR code located on the business’s access pass before entering the store.

When it comes to tracking scan results, one method they use is to create a dynamic QR code that unlocks more functionality than regular QR codes.

Catalogues that aren’t printed

Because some retail stores sell a variety of things from different aisles and floors, aisle product catalogs can assist buyers in determining which aisle the item they need is located in, saving time and exposing themselves to the ongoing viral threat they’ve been trying to avoid.

Retailers can use a PDF QR code to place a digital copy of the product catalogs they have for each aisle and have customers scan them whenever they come across these aisles to see if the product is properly positioned.

Payments

Because most retailers are doing everything they can to prevent the COVID-19 infection from spreading during their business hours, most have adopted the rule to take digital payments.

With many digital wallets incorporating the usage of QR codes to scan and transfer payments, merchants are also displaying these codes on their counters for customers to scan. Retailers can then confirm if the payment went through using the receipt they will send them.

Self-checkouts

Because examining the products sold in-store can be a time-consuming task for most self-checkout customers, the inclusion of QR codes in their checkout process has proven to be extremely beneficial. The time spent conducting a self-checkout will be reduced because they will simply need to scan them through the checkout machine. They save more time shopping at retail stores that employ self-checkout systems as a result of this.
